Transaction 078efdc9355be1982e0f76032fcffacbb8ce7eee6cd1845eb60f4abfc226152b
1 Input
1 Output
-
078efdc9355be1982e0f76032fcffacbb8ce7eee6cd1845eb60f4abfc226152b:0
- value
- 690206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8d292fe3c3aca37f88ba3458def63eb32a3b10c OP_EQUAL
- address
- 3KzsKruGsBH7oSZiRJw3cXNok6ivvcdLwd